Greenspan: Trust must be restored

Greenspan said that the impact of stock options has reversed and is now making corporate profits look worse than they really are because officers and employees are demanding cash compensation instead of stock options, which makes it look as if expenses are rising.

"It is not that humans have become any more greedy than in generations past," Greenspan said. "It is that the avenues to express greed had grown so enormously."
